Management of marae to be restructured

The management structure of the Nga Hau E Wha National Marae in Christchurch will be overhauled after a meeting of 150 Maori elders and marae trustees yesterday. The restructuring comes after a year of controversy for the marae with probes into the alleged abuse of public funds and the police report into contract work schemes which alleged poor financial administration and overspending of funds on marae projects. The secretary of the Board of Trustees, Mr Hori Brennan, will have his duties cut markedly under the restructuring. Mr Brennan offered his resignation to the meeting but the meeting unanimously decided not to accept it. Mr Brennan said after the meeting that he had put forward the proposal to restructure management of the marae and it had been accepted in principle. The board of trustees will meet tomorrow to discuss details of the restructuring. Mr Brennan, who has been secretary for seven years, said he was happy at the outcome of the meeting. He said he wanted to spend more time with his family and the pressure of

the job had sometimes been too much for one person. Mr Brennan, aged 55, is a diabetic and said his doctor had warned him to reduce his workload or his health would suffer badly. The meeting also discussed the police report and the wide criticism generated by the news media. Mr Brennan said many Maori elders had been upset at the events of the last year but the meeting went a long way toward restoring the unity of people involved with the marae. He said it had been confirmed that the meeting house would be officially opened within seven months. “The public will then be able to see the tremendous work that has gone on here.”
